Information for DEEPSEA/bionet.biology.deepsea (moderated) USENET Newsgroup name: bionet.biology.deepsea Status: Moderated One Line description: Research in deep-sea marine biology, oceanography, and geology Moderation address: bionet-biology-deepsea@net.bio.net (deepsea-moderator@net.bio.net is an alias for the above) Moderator: Andrew Grant McArthur University of Victoria Mailing list name: DEEPSEA E-mail posting address: deepsea@net.bio.net Newsgroup charter: The DEEPSEA mailing list (hosted by the University of Victoria) has been in operation for over four years, has a membership exceeding 650 researchers, and has subscriptions from over 35 countries. Frequent uses of DEEPSEA have included searches for specialist literature or opinion, specimen exchange, technical discussions, and general discussions about deep-sea marine biology, oceanography, and geology. Geologists and oceanographers have been most welcome, but nearly all of DEEPSEA's subscribers are biologists interested in biological aspects of the deep-sea. DEEPSEA is not associated with any professional society. I will be leaving the University of Victoria in the next year so DEEPSEA requires a stable host network and good archiving systems. BIONET has these resources. Additionally, I hope that the inclusion of DEEPSEA on the USENET will result in additional subscriptions and discussions.
